How similar are FREL and IYR?
Fidelity MSCI Real Estate Index ETF (FREL, by Fidelity) holds 127 positions; iShares U.S. Real Estate ETF (IYR, by iShares) holds 61. They have 56 holdings in common, and by portfolio weight the two funds are 86.6% identical. In practical terms the pair is essentially interchangeable, so holding both adds little diversification.

How much do FREL and IYR overlap?
FREL and IYR overlap by 86.6% of portfolio weight. They share 56 holdings (FREL holds 127 positions and IYR holds 61), based on each fund's latest SEC-reported holdings.
Is it redundant to own both FREL and IYR?
The two portfolios are 86.6% identical by weight. Owning both is largely redundant: they are close to the same portfolio, so a second position mostly duplicates the first.
What are the biggest shared holdings of FREL and IYR?
The largest positions held by both funds are WELL, PLD, EQIX, AMT and DLR. Together the top 10 shared positions account for 54% of the total overlap.
What does FREL own that IYR doesn't?
71 positions (12.1% of FREL) are unique to FREL, led by CTRE, AHR and TRNO. In the other direction, 5 positions (3.1% of IYR) are unique to IYR.
